Not super high performance, but we are putting a Classic Performance Products box on a 60 right now. We have their 500 series boxes on a bunch of tri fives and have been real happy with them. For a street cruiser they are great.

Oh yeah, no adapter needed, they bolt right on. they also have a drag link kit that comes with a pitman arm and idler and eliminates the old style adjustable ball and socket thing on the drag link.

I was wrong it wasn't the 605 it was CPP's 500 box that was causing radiator inteference for some guys.

So your 500 fit OK?

Stormed_Norm
08-26-2011, 10:48 PM
I used a 500 in my 62 Biscayne, I ground off the top rib that was touching the radiator, was getting worried about how much meat was left to grind off, but made if flush with the body and there's a 1/4 clearance between the box and rad.
